Crystal structure of Putative cell invasion protein with MAC/Perforin domain (NP_812351.1) from BACTERIODES THETAIOTAOMICRON VPI-5482 at 2.46 A resolution
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, SITTING DROP | 6.7 | 277 | 5.0000% 2-methyl-2,4-pentanediol, 12.0000% polyethylene glycol 6000, 0.1M HEPES pH 6.7, NANODROP', VAPOR DIFFUSION, SITTING DROP, temperature 277K |
